The Trinidad and Tobago Meteorological Service has officially declared the start of the 2025 Dry Season. In an update today, the Met Office said it’s observed a reduction in the frequency of showery and/or rainy weather, as well as other synoptic features such as: The intensification and equatorward migration of the North Atlantic Sub-Tropical High Pressure cell; Strengthened Trade-wind inversion (west Africa, central tropical Atlantic and eastern Caribbean); Upper-Level Westerly winds; Inter-Tropical Convergence Zone (ITCZ) in its southernmost position across the tropical Atlantic Ocean.
